To standardise a solution of potassium permanganate of approximate concentration 0.2 mol L–1, an analyst took 25.00 mL
of the solution and made it up to 250.00 mL in a volumetric flask. He then measured out 1.117 g of oxalic acid crystals, and
made it up to 250.00 mL in another volumetric flask, using sulfuric acid of approximate concentration 0.2 mol L–1.
Next, 20.00 mL aliquots of the oxalic acid were titrated against the diluted potassium permanganate solution. The end point
was detected at the first permanent pink colour. The mean titre was found to be 18.95 mL.

1. equation= 2MnO4- + 5H2C4O4 +6H+ -----> 2Mn 2+ +10CO2 +8H20

I know this is an stupid question, but are why is there the use of sulfuric acid?
